Senior Analyst, Specialty Compliance and Ethics

The Global Marketplace Ecommerce Compliance Group within Walmart is responsible for defining, enforcing and promoting policies, programs and products to ensure safe transactions and create trust across our online and marketplace businesses. The Sr. Analyst position is responsible for reviewing internal and external item reports, conducting monitoring/QA for accuracy, analyzing item data and helping to develop rules to enforce policies. This role will partner with various teams including eCommerce Compliance, Policy Governance, Merchant and Retail teams, Operations, Corporate Affairs and Product. An ideal candidate has extensive Intellectual Property, Brand Portal and Rights Owner experience. We are looking for a cross-functional, team player who is highly customer focused and is a detail-oriented, self-starter to support and assist in item risk management that operates with a sense of urgency, is comfortable working in a dynamic online environment with shifting business needs and changing requirements.

What Youll Do:

  • Site Monitoring & Compliance: Monitor the site to ensure all items comply with established policies, rules, and guidelines.
  • Escalation Triage & Action: Triage escalations by reviewing items and listings, taking appropriate action on products, and providing feedback to improve rules, tools, or processes.
  • Risk Analysis & Investigation: Review and investigate item reports for gaps, trends, or emerging risks, including analysis of internal data, external sites, news, and supporting machine learning model annotations.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borate with Compliance, Business, Legal and Corporate Affairs leadership to assess, prioritize, and resolve high-impact item escalations efficiently.
  • Process Support & Documentation: Support process documentation, generate reports, and coordinate the implementation of new item risk initiatives, processes, or workflows.
  • Workflow Optimization: Utilize enterprise tools and data resources to streamline workflows, enhance monitoring, and improve decision-making efficiency.
  • Performance & Communication: Deliver against KPIs, maintain high standards of execution, communicate effectively at all organizational levels, and invest in continuous self-development
